How Ceiling Drywall Water Damage Restoration Works in the Area
Our team’s process is designed to be efficient, effective, and stress-free for you. We understand the importance of acting quickly with water damage. Don’t let it spread.
Step 1: Assessment and Inspection
Our technicians will assess the damage, identify the source of the water, and provide a detailed report on the extent of the damage. Get a clear picture of what’s happening. This step usually takes around 30 minutes to an hour.
Step 2: Water Extraction
Using state-of-the-art equipment, we’ll extract as much water as possible from the affected area. Get rid of the water for good. This step typically takes around 1-2 hours, depending on the size of the area.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
Our technicians will use specialized equipment to dry and dehumidify the area, ensuring that it’s completely dry and free from moisture. No more dampness or mold. This step usually takes around 3-5 days, depending on the severity of the damage.
Step 4: Ceiling Drywall Repair
We’ll repair or replace any damaged ceiling drywall, ensuring that your home is safe, secure, and looks great. Get your home back on track. This step usually takes around 1-3 days, depending on the extent of the damage.
Step 5: Final Inspection and Clean-up
Our technicians will conduct a final inspection to ensure that the area is completely dry, safe, and clean. No lingering water or mold issues. This step usually takes around 30 minutes to an hour.

Ceiling Drywall Water Damage Restoration Cost In Bessemer City, NC
Prices for ceiling drywall water damage restoration can vary depending on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ions. Get a free estimate today to learn more.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area and type of equipment needed. |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$1,000 – $5,000 | Severity of damage and size of affected area. |
| Ceiling Drywall Repair | $1,500 – $10,000 | Extent of damage and type of repair needed. |
| Final Inspection and Clean-up |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area and level of cleaning required. |
| More Services (e.g. Mold remediation) | $1,000 – $5,000 | Severity of mold growth and type of remediation needed. |
Exact pricing will depend on an on-site assessment and may vary based on the specifics of your situation. Get a free estimate today to learn more.
